Layer 2 Ethereum solution Mantle declared that its testnet launch had been successful. Developers can now register and submit an application to gain access to the testnet.
Ethereum Layer 2 Network Mantle Testnet Is Now Live

BitDAO created the optimistic rollup known as Mantle. It employs a modular structure, where the essential operations of a blockchain are carried out on specialized levels, with the goal of lowering costs and improving overall performance. With 37,000 developers already signed up for the launch, BitDAO has opened the testnet.

Before the mainnet launch, which is slated for later in the year, Mantle will be able to test and build new features for the chain on the “Wadsley” testnet. The public can access the testnet, and developers are encouraged to sign up to test their applications on the network.

Ethereum Layer 2 Network Mantle Testnet Is Now Live

BitDAO introduced Mantle in November as a modular Ethereum Layer 2 network. For handling network operations like a consensus, transaction execution, and settlement, modular networks contain different layers. They are a more recent iteration of the blockchain architecture, as opposed to earlier monolithic chains when all network operations took place on the same base layer.

The DAO reaffirmed that Mantle would provide quicker finality at lower transaction costs. The announcement also stated that multi-party computation would be used by the network. Nodes that are specifically intended to handle off-chain transactions are used in this form of processing.

One way Layer 2 networks function to reduce the risk associated with transactions carried out outside the base layer of a blockchain network is through multi-party computation.
